However, the mechanisms by which these sugars modulate antitumor immunity as well as therapeutic strategies directed against them are limited. Knocking out a key gene in sialic acid metabolism, Cmas, inhibits synthesis of the activated form of sialic acid, cytidine monophosphate-sialic acid and decreases the formation of lung metastases in vivo. Thus, the sialic acid pathway may be a new target against metastatic breast cancer. Sialic acid-rich glycoproteins (sialoglycoproteins) bind selectin in humans and other organisms.

Serum sialic acid was significantly greater in cancer patients than in normals. Cancer patients with metastases had significantly greater sialic acid than cancer patients without metastases.

Sialic acid expression influences cancer cell-cell adhesion, cell-extracellular matrix adhesion, as well as emboli formation, apoptosis and cell growth. Serum lipid-bound sialic acid (LSA) was measured with a recently described procedure in 108 healthy subjects and in 138 patients with a variety of solid tumors and hematologic malignancies. At the time of serum sampling, 128 patients had active disease and 10 patients had no evidence of disease.
